Hong Kong’s exports rise sharply as demand for AI-related products strengthens. Provisional data from the city’s Census and Statistics Department show exports increase 53.4% year on year in June, reaching a record HK$641.1 billion (about US$81.7 billion). The June increase follows a 40.8% jump in May, when exports also expanded on strong overseas demand. Multiple reports link the growth to the global buildout of AI infrastructure, which is boosting purchases of electronics and related components. One outlet notes outbound shipments surge 53.4% in May, attributing the rise to higher global demand for electronic products tied to AI infrastructure. Another report highlights that the June increase is the sharpest year-on-year rise in decades, describing it as the strongest growth period since the late 1980s. Together, the sources present a consistent picture of rapid export growth over consecutive months, with AI-related electronics cited as a key driver of demand.
